Top Budget Controllers for Nintendo Switch in 2026
We've reviewed multiple controllers based on price, build quality, compatibility, and user reviews. Here are the top contenders:
1. PowerA Enhanced Wireless Controller
The PowerA Enhanced Wireless Controller offers a comfortable grip, responsive buttons, and wireless connectivity. Priced around $45, it is one of the most popular choices for budget-conscious gamers. It features a standard button layout and a textured grip for better handling during intense gaming sessions.
2. Hori Split Pad Pro
The Hori Split Pad Pro is designed for handheld mode, providing full-sized buttons and joysticks. It is wired, which ensures minimal latency, and costs approximately $40. Its ergonomic design reduces fatigue during long gaming sessions, making it ideal for portable gaming.
3. PDP Gaming Wired Controller
This wired controller from PDP Gaming is known for its durability and reliable performance. Priced at around $30, it features a standard layout with additional programmable buttons, making it versatile for various game genres. Its wired connection guarantees a lag-free experience.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Budget Controller
When selecting a budget controller, consider the following factors:
- Connectivity: Wireless vs. wired based on your gaming setup.
- Ergonomics: Comfort during long gaming sessions.
- Build Quality: Durability and material quality.
- Compatibility: Ensure it works seamlessly with your Nintendo Switch.
- Additional Features: Programmable buttons, textured grips, or customizable options.
